Staying Active During The Pandemic – WHO

Physical activity also helps improve sleep habits which are important for good health. So instead of doing nothing at home, it is best to do light activities around the home.

The World Health Organization or WHO recommends that all adults do physical activity for 30 minutes a day and children should exercise for one hour a day. Avoid heavy workouts instead of trying simple stretching exercises.

Here’s how you can stay active while at home:

  • Register for exercise classes online
  • Dance
  • Play video games that require you to move around
  • Jump Rope
  • Do exercise and strengthen muscles and balance exercises
  • Go up and down the stairs and if you don’t have a ladder, replace it with a bench
  • Do some stretching exercises
  • Can find other exercise ideas online

Overcome the challenges of working from home in this simple way:

  • Check your sitting posture often
  • Don’t just sit around. Make sure you get up and do stretching exercises or walking so that you feel refreshed at work.
